Hi,

I have mostly worked as a freelancer and have been in a regular job since feb 2018- Aug 2019. My issue here is that I did not recieve the pay regularly. There are some months when i was not paid due to financial issues at the company and that payment is still pending for payment , meaning that I will soon be paid for about 4-5 months that they missed on as a lump sum amount.


Is this going to be an issue? Do I have to show bank statements for the whole job duration or few months is enough? Or are salary slips/offer letter with CTC sufficient?

Do i also need to show proof of payments for my older freelance work?

Salary slips are not part of standard documents that are required. As long as you have a reference letter that states your monthly or yearly compensation, you would be fine on a company letterhead.
